博客
关于我
Linux(Centos)上使用crontab实现定时任务(定时执行脚本)
阅读量:790 次
发布时间:2023-02-02

本文共 931 字,大约阅读时间需要 3 分钟。

herkes bu млн zf qwe rty jwt hlkj sam十五 encryption type using aes gcm?

嗯,这是一个关于在Linux上实现定时任务的教程。crontab是一个强大的任务调度工具,可以在指定的时间自动执行一系列命令。以下步骤将指导您如何使用crontab在Linux上创建一个定时任务。

实现步骤

  • 新建清理脚本

    首先,我们需要创建一个新的sh脚本来清理指定的文件夹。假设我们想清理/var/test目录下的所有文件。执行以下命令创建clean.sh脚本:

    touch /var/test/clean.sh

    然后,打开clean.sh脚本并添加以下内容:

  • #!/bin/bashcd /var/test > logs.log

    保存并关闭编辑器。脚本将连接到/var/test目录,并将输出写入logs.log文件。2. **设置定时任务**  接下来,我们需要将这个脚本添加到crontab的任务列表中。启动终端并使用以下命令进入crontab编辑模式:```bashcrontab -e

    在编辑器中,输入以下crontab表达式来设置每分钟执行一次的任务:

    * * * * * /var/test/clean.sh

    这里的星号表示每个小时、每天、每周等的所有值,前面的“*”表示分钟。因此,这个表达式表示每隔一分钟执行一次clean.sh脚本。

    1. 验证配置

      保存并退出编辑器后,您可以在/var/test目录中查看是否有logs.log文件并添加一些内容。如果一切正确,等待一分钟后,您应该看到logs.log被清理。

    2. 查看日志

      如果需要监控脚本的执行情况,可以使用以下命令查看crond服务的日志:

      tail -f /var/log/cron

      这将使您看到最新的日志输出,包括脚本执行的结果和任何错误信息。

    3. 注意事项

      • 确保将脚本的路径正确输入。如果您的脚本在bin目录中,可能需要添加完整路径。
      • 确保脚本有执行权限。使用chmod +x clean.sh命令赋予执行权限。
      • 如果脚本运行速度较快,考虑添加sleep命令以减少系统负载。

      通过以上步骤,您可以轻松地在Linux上配置定时任务,并定期执行清理操作。

    转载地址:http://ygwfk.baihongyu.com/

    你可能感兴趣的文章
    Linux 网络扫描工具:nmap,涨知识的时间到了!
    查看>>
    Linux 网络排查必备:轻松找出进程占用的端口号
    查看>>
    linux 网络状况流量分析shell脚本
    查看>>
    Linux 网络管理及监控与性能评估
    查看>>
    linux 自动重启崩溃的进程
    查看>>
    linux 获取文件的行数
    查看>>
    linux 获取文件的行数
    查看>>
    linux 获取链表节点数,LINUX基础-list链表
    查看>>
    linux 虚拟化
    查看>>
    Linux 装机后服务器调优配置
    查看>>
    Linux 解决E: Sub-process /usr/bin/dpkg returned an error code (1)错误
    查看>>
    Linux 解决“/bin/bash^M: bad interpreter: No such file or directory”
    查看>>
    Linux 解决代理产生的Failed to connect to 127.0.0.1 port 58895: Connection refused问题
    查看>>
    Linux 解决错误File “/usr/bin/yum“, line 30 except KeyboardInterrupt, e:
    查看>>
    linux 解压tar包
    查看>>
    Linux 计划任务详解
    查看>>
    Linux 计划任务详解
    查看>>
    linux 让php支持mysql_转 linux下php扩展mysqli的支持
    查看>>
    Linux 设置/删除环境变量
    查看>>
    linux 访问mysql
    查看>>